5: DELETE TRACK [SONG] → [A]~[H] → [SONG JOB] → [MENU] → 5:Delete Track → [ENTER/YES] Deletes all data from the specified track. This job is not available when the rhythm track (track 9) is selected. SONG`JOB`Delete`Track F1 F2 F3 F4 F5 F6 F7 F8 CS1 CS2 CS3 CS4 CS5 CS6 CS7 CS8 Use the GROUP [A] through [H] keys to select the track you want to delete (A = track1, B = track 2, and so on). The LED of the selected track will glow red while the LEDs of all other tracks containing data glow green. Press [ENTER/YES] to begin the delete procedure. The following confirmation display will appear: SONG`JOB`Delete`Track Are`you`sure`? Press [ENTER/YES] again to confirm that you want to go ahead with the delete operation, or press [EXIT/NO] to cancel. When the track has been deleted, "Completed!" will appear briefly on the display.
